Neutron strength of the 5.08-MeV 32+ state of O17

H. T. Fortune and C. M. Vincent
Phys. Rev. C 10, 1233(R) – Published 1 September 1974
PDFExport Citation

Abstract

The data for the reaction O16(d,p)O17 to the unbound state at 5.08 MeV have been reanalyzed by using average sets of optical-model parameters and standard parameters for the transferred-particle well. Still, the neutron width extracted from the (d,p) data is only 23 of the measured width.

NUCLEAR STRUCTURE O16(d,p) (5.08 MeV), dependence of extracted spectroscopic factor on details of unbound DWBA calculation.
